Lean Logistics

A common misconception of Lean philosophy is that it only finds application in manufacturing settings. However, the impact of Lean on the logistician is significant. A goal of Lean is to eliminate waste, decrease work-in-process inventories, and, in turn, decrease process and manufacturing lead-times; ultimately increasing supply chain capability and flow. Logistics flow is paramount to Lean Thinking!

Standardized Work

Standardization of production operations in a key element of Lean Manufacturing. The standardization process is the process of selecting the best know method of performing a given activity, it is also the process of establishing, sustaining and improving the best production practices.

Value Stream Mapping

Value Stream Mapping is a method for identification of all the activities currently required to bring a product through the production system from raw material into the arms of the customer.

SMED

The effect of SMED implementation is usually an over 50% reduction in changeover time, what allowes to reduce batch sizes, lowers a level of inventories, increases machine efficiency as well as reduces lead time. Finally production costs are significantly reduced.

Level Pull System

Level Pull System it is a way to create stable, repeatable production and to reconcile it with unstable, variable customer demand.
